Quick and easy workaround:
1) Go to your Stellaris game folder (Steam/steamapps/common/Stellaris)
2) Go to common/defines and open 00_defines.txt in Notepad or another text editor
3) CTRL+F and search for EMPIRE_SIZE
4) Edit the values to match the mod description. This is really intuitive and easy to do even if you are not a Programmer.
5) Save the file and disable this mod in the launcher until it's patched.
